Belfast Private Tours

A seamless blend of modernity and tradition, Belfast is known for its meteoric rise as a favored tourist hotspot over the past few years. A famous port city, Belfast today is sought after for its elegant Victorian landmarks, glitzy waterfront attractions, and fabulous gastronomic experiences. A trip to this sprawling metropolis is incomplete without a visit to the awe-inspiring Titanic Belfast, an iconic reminder of the city’s maritime heritage and the ill-fated liner. The marvelous Ulster Museum with its expansive collection of world art, and Belfast City Hall with its exquisite stained glass windows, are a must visit for your fix of history. Nearby, the execution chamber and flogging room at Crumlin Road Gaol, known as one of the haunted sites in the city, make for a fun visit although not for the faint of heart! Weekend mornings are best spent at the renovated Saint George’s Market – a foodie’s delight offering mouthwatering specialties ranging from Ulster fry to Belfast soda bread and yummy fudge. Experience the outdoors at Cave Hill Country Park, with a cliff that inspired Jonathan’s Swift’s Gulliver’s Travels, numerous walking trails, and a spectacular castle and fort.
